I say get it. But skip the antenna-x one. The mount they supply to make it a universal fit is simply a plastic tube. As such, any sideways pressure on the antenna (ie branch, carwash, little kids) can cause it to "break". The antenna itself is OK, and the company is good to deal with, but after purchasing one myself, I would highly recommend another brand. Another problem it has, is that if you have added an aftermarket antenna mount cover, the plastic base it too big to fit in the hole and has to be "modified" One like Dennis has, is clearly superior, and is about the same price. It has a great mount and comes in different "colors".
